China Expected To Purchase 200 Million Gallons Of U.S. Ethanol In First Half Of 2021

China is expected to purchase a large amount of U.S. ethanol this year with the expected buy in the next six months expected to be close to 200 million gallons. That follows a huge purchase by the Chinese of U.S. corn earlier this week. Renewable Fuels Association President and CEO Geoff Cooper says if China follows through with this commitment it’ll be great for the U.S. ethanol industry.

He says given all the pressure ethanol plants have been under the past two years having this purchase gives the industry a real needed economic shot in the arm.

Cooper says not only is China an important market for U.S. ethanol, there are also other market opportunities the industry is exploring and optimistic about for 2021.

Earlier this week China purchased 53.5 million bushels of corn from the U.S., it’s biggest buy since last July.
